Mini Van Crashes into Family Dollar during Burglary
The following information was supplied by the Baltimore County Police Department. In cases where a criminal charge is noted, the information provided does not indicate a conviction.

A mini van driven by two males crashed into the front of the Family Dollar store on Edmondson Avenue during a burglary.
At 4:35 a.m. Thursday, the pair got into the business at 5511 Edmondson Ave., by walking through the damage, according to a report by the Baltimore County Police Department's Wilkens precinct.
Nothing was stolen, the report states. The van, a gray Chrysler with front-end damage, was driven away southbound on Northbend Road toward Frederick Road.
